Hey members, I've just published 11 new shortcuts from today's stream featuring the new actions from the Things beta.
Picks a random Area, then a Project, then opens it in Things.
Generate a widget chart based on your completed vs total tasks for the day.
Creates a project for a Folder in Shortcuts, then adds each shortcut as a to-do with a link to open the shortcut.
Asks you to choose a Reminders list, then reminders from that list, then exports them into Things and deletes the originals.
Takes an item ID and adds it to the Things deep link back to that item.
Asks you to pick an area, then project from that area, then opens it in Things.
Opens Things for Mac on the current device or remotely via SSH from other devices.
Opens a custom “Templates” folder in Notes where I keep notes I want to duplicate.
Sets the Apple Watch to silent mode, turns on Do Not Disturb, sets the volume to 0% and vibrates if run from iPhone.
Prompts you type in new todos in new lines and add them for Today immediately in Things. If you share text in, it’ll use that instead.
